Portsmouth & Southsea Station is well-equipped with amenities ensuring a smooth and seamless travel experience. The ticket office operates with generous opening times, from early morning until late evening throughout the week and boasts efficient ticket machines, including smartcard validators and machines accommodating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Access calls to those with mobility considerations, as the station is equipped with step-free access across its platforms, accessible toilet facilities, and ramps for train access. CCTV systems are in place throughout the station, enhancing security measures for all travelers.
Waiting rooms with ample seating are available on platforms 1 and 2, providing comfort while waiting for your train. If you arrive with time to spare, a cup of coffee at Costa Coffee, conveniently located just outside the station, might be the perfect way to start your journey. For any assistance, customer help points are ready to guide and support you with your travel plans.

Sellafield station may not boast extensive amenities, but it offers all the essentials for a traveler. Although there's no ticket office, ticket machines are available, making it easy to collect pre-purchased tickets or buy new ones. This station supports smartcards, though you won't find any validators. Accessibility is considered, with step-free entry partially available, particularly towards the Barrow platform. For assistance, passengers can use the helpline or departure screens for up-to-date travel information. Unfortunately, Sellafield lacks public Wi-Fi and refreshment options, but it does have an ATM for any cash needs.
Convenient travel options await outside the station. Should you find the regular train services unavailable, the Rail Replacement Service operates right in front of the station. For more flexible travel, taxis are readily accessible, and information can be found on the cab booking platform. Bus connections are provided by Busline, offering a mode of travel that enriches your experience of the picturesque surroundings of Cumbria.
